Has anyone else had their NAV system "killed" when TSB 12-BE-012 was performed (DIS Operating S/W Update)?

Last week I had my Genny in the shop for a CEL (P0150 - O2 sensor failure).

Since it was going to be in for service anyways, I asked my service rep to do TSB 12-BE-012, which is the purported fix for issues like the audio system being muted at start-up, voice recognition failures, and surround sound going to OFF at start-up. I've had 3-4 instances of these issues since I bought my Genny in 2009, so I figured I'd get it taken care of now that they had a TSB on it.

When I got my car back, the NAV sytems was inoperative. When I checked the ENG page, the S/W listings for the Navi system and map database were blank, so it appears they were deleted when the TSB was performed. My Genny went back in the shop again and my service guy has not been able to get the NAV system to reload. He's checking with the HMA tech guys for recommendations. I'm just wondering if anyone else has experienced this and, if so, what their resolution was.

I had the TSB 12-BE-012-1 applied to my 2010 4.6 Tech last week. It took 1 and 1/2 hour to complete and everything went fine. We had the engine during the whole time and since it was the first software upgrade that this dealer performed on any car, they allowed me to sit in the passenger seat and watch the whole process. The first 40 minutes was for the UTA (amplifier) software update, after that it rebooted and started upgrading the Head Unit software plus other systems.
